晚唐五代越窑青瓷碗和宋代磁州窑盆修复中配补材料的选择与使用  

Selection and Application of Complementary Materials in the Restoration of Yue Kiln Celadon Bowl During Late Tang and Five Dynasties and Cizhou Kiln Basin During Song Dynasty

摘  要:本文以晚唐五代越窑青瓷碗和宋代磁州窑盆为修复对象,重点对陶瓷修复过程中所用配补材料进行对比实验,以达到选择最优配补材料的目的。实验对象为滑石粉、高岭土、金刚砂、石膏粉、白炭黑、瓷粉等填充材料,实验仪器选择syntek邵氏硬度计和Q-Sun氙灯全光谱模拟器,通过测试环氧树脂调和不同填充材料后的硬度和耐老化性,对比得出实验样品的数值并分析优缺点。研究发现,滑石粉、石膏粉、瓷粉和高岭土在陶瓷器修复中具有优势。因其优良的耐老化性和合适的硬度,最终分别选用石膏粉和滑石粉作为填充材料,恢复了文物的结构稳定性,完成了两件瓷器的保护修复。This paper takes the celadon bowl of the Yue kiln of the late Tang and Five Dynasties and the Cizhou kiln basin of the Song Dynasty as the restoration objects,and focuses on the comparative experiment of the matching materials used in the ceramic restoration process to achieve the purpose of selecting the optimal matching materials.The experimental instrument selected syntek Shore hardness tester and Q-Sun xenon lamp full-spectrum simulator,and compared the hardness and aging resistance of epoxy resin after blending different filling materials,comparing the values of experimental samples and analyzing the advantages and disadvantages.Talcum powder,gypsum powder,porcelain powder and kaolin are considered to have advantages in ceramic restoration.Because of its excellent aging resistance and suitable hardness,gypsum powder and talcum powder were finally selected as flling materials,which restored the structural stability of cultural relics and completed the protection and restoration of two pieces of porcelain in the late Tang Dynasty and Song Dynasty.
